Viral Green Goddess Salad Recipe (Easy Chopped Bowl)

The Ultimate Fresh Chopped Salad Experience

This fresh viral green goddess salad combines crisp, finely shredded white cabbage, diced cucumber, and green onions with a vibrant avocado herb dressing. Blending ripe avocado, fresh basil, parsley, garlic, lemon juice, and olive oil produces a rich, nutrient-dense coating that transforms raw vegetables into an addictive, spoonable bowl.

Unlike traditional leaf salads that wilt quickly under heavy dressings, dense cruciferous bases retain their crunch for hours. Serving this green bowl alongside tortilla chips or eating it directly with a spoon makes it as versatile as it is refreshing.

How Do You Make Viral Green Goddess Salad?

Make the viral green goddess salad by finely shredding 300g white cabbage, dicing 1 cucumber, and slicing 3 green onions. Blend 1 ripe avocado, fresh basil, parsley, garlic, lemon juice, olive oil, salt, and pepper until creamy, then toss thoroughly with the vegetables until evenly coated.

Essential Ingredients and Culinary Breakdown

Using fresh green produce delivers bright flavors, vibrant natural color, and a nutrient-packed profile.

Salad Base Components

  • 300g White Cabbage: Shredded very finely to provide a dense, crunch-filled structure.
  • 1 English Cucumber (approx. 250g): Deseeded and cut into small, uniform cubes.
  • 3 Green Onions: Thinly sliced to add a mild, savory edge.
  • 1-2 Tablespoons Fresh Chives or Parsley: Finely chopped for an extra herbal note.

Creamy Avocado Herb Dressing

  • 1 Ripe Avocado (approx. 120-150g): Forms the luscious, healthy-fat foundation.
  • 20g Fresh Basil (1 large handful): Imparts a sweet, aromatic fragrance.
  • 20g Fresh Parsley (1 large handful): Adds an earthy, clean flavor profile.
  • 1 Small Garlic Clove & 1 Small Onion: Provides savory sharpness.
  • 30ml Fresh Lemon Juice: Adds citrus brightness and prevents avocado oxidation.
  • 30-40ml Extra Virgin Olive Oil: Emulsifies the dressing into a silky finish.
  • Salt and Black Pepper: Adjusted to taste for optimal flavor balance.

Optional Creaminess Boosters

  • 2-3 Tablespoons Yogurt or Skyr: Increases protein content and adds a light tangy note.
  • 1 Tablespoon Cashew Butter: Adds rich, nutty creaminess for dairy-free diets.
  • 2-3 Tablespoons Nutritional Yeast: Provides a savory, cheese-like flavor boost.

Step-by-Step Preparation Guide

Precision in chopping the vegetables and properly emulsifying the dressing guarantees an ideal balance in every bite.

Step 1: Prep the Crunchy Salad Base

Place the white cabbage on a sturdy cutting board and slice it ultra-thin using a sharp chef’s knife or mandoline. Slice the cucumber lengthwise, scoop out the seeds with a spoon to avoid excess moisture, and cut it into tiny, uniform cubes. Thinly chop the green onions along with any optional chives or parsley, then combine all prepared vegetables in a large mixing bowl.

Step 2: Blend the Green Dressing

Scoop the avocado flesh directly into a high-speed blender or food processor. Add the fresh basil leaves, parsley, garlic clove, peeled onion, lemon juice, extra virgin olive oil, salt, and black pepper. Add optional boosters like yogurt, cashew butter, or nutritional yeast if desired. Blend on high speed until completely smooth, brilliant green, and creamy, adding a small splash of water if the mixture is too thick to catch the blades.

Step 3: Combine and Marinate

Pour the rich green dressing over the bowl of prepared raw vegetables. Using two spoons or salad tongs, mix vigorously until every piece of cabbage and cucumber is coated. Serve immediately for maximum crunch, or let the bowl rest in the refrigerator for 10 to 15 minutes to allow the flavors to meld together.

Key Takeaways

  • Finely Diced Structure: Cutting vegetables small allows the salad to be eaten like a dip with chips or a spoon.
  • Avocado Base: Ripe avocado creates a velvety, nutrient-dense dressing without heavy mayonnaise.
  • Balanced Nutrition: Each serving yields approximately 320 kcal, 26g healthy fats, 5g protein, 7g carbohydrates, and 7g dietary fiber.
  • Meal-Prep Friendly: The sturdy cabbage base holds its texture without softening quickly.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I make the green goddess salad dressing without a blender?

A high-speed blender or food processor works best to break down dense herbs and garlic. However, you can finely mash the avocado with a fork and mincing the herbs, garlic, and onion before whisking aggressively with lemon juice and olive oil.

How long does the viral green goddess salad last in the fridge?

Stored in an airtight container, the dressed cabbage salad stays fresh and crunchy for up to 2 days in the refrigerator. The acidity from the lemon juice helps maintain the vibrant green color of the avocado dressing.

How do I prevent cucumber from making the salad watery?

Deseeding the cucumber before dicing removes excess liquid, ensuring your green goddess dressing stays thick and creamy instead of becoming diluted.

What can I serve with this green salad?

This versatile salad can be eaten as a main meal, served alongside tortilla chips as a dip, or used as a crunchy topping for grilled proteins and grain bowls.
